How Psoufauh.com Operates

Trojan-type threats like Psoufauh.com typically operate by disguising themselves as legitimate software or attachments. Once executed, they can create backdoors, allowing remote access to the infected system. This access can be used for a variety of malicious activities, including data theft, installation of additional malware, or using the system as part of a botnet for malicious activities like DDoS attacks or spamming.

These threats often exploit vulnerabilities in software or human behavior, such as opening malicious email attachments, clicking on links to malicious websites, or downloading software from untrusted sources. The ability of Psoufauh.com to operate undetected for a period depends on its sophistication and the security measures in place on the infected system.

Symptoms of Infection

Symptoms of a Psoufauh.com infection can vary but may include unusual system behavior such as slow performance, frequent crashes, or unfamiliar programs and icons appearing on the desktop. Users might also notice increased network activity, even when no programs are running, or find that their antivirus software is disabled. In some cases, the infection might not display overt symptoms, making it difficult for users to detect without the aid of security software.

How to Remove Psoufauh.com

  1. Enter Safe Mode with Networking to limit the malware's ability to interfere with the removal process. This mode allows you to use the internet to download removal tools while limiting other programs from running.
  2. Download and run a full scan with a reputable anti-malware tool, such as SpyHunter. Ensure the tool is updated to the latest version to increase the chances of detecting and removing the threat.
  3. Uninstall suspicious programs that were installed around the time the threat was detected. Use the Control Panel or Settings app to review installed programs and remove any that are unfamiliar or unnecessary.
  4. Reset your web browsers (Chrome, Firefox, Edge, etc.) to their default settings. This step can help remove any malicious extensions or settings changes made by the malware. You can usually find this option in the browser's settings or preferences menu.
  5. Reboot your system and perform another scan with your anti-malware tool to ensure the threat has been completely removed. Rebooting helps to ensure that any malware that was running in memory is cleared out, and the follow-up scan verifies that no remnants of the malware remain.
